Comprehending Dodge Ram Parts Dealers

Dodge Ram parts dealers are specialized sellers or outlets that focus on offering parts and devices particularly for Dodge Ram trucks. They can be official dealers licensed by the maker or independent merchants using a series of OEM (Original Equipment Manufacturer) and aftermarket parts.

Types of Dodge Ram Parts

Before going over car dealerships, it's important to comprehend the kinds of parts available for Dodge Ram trucks:

Part TypeDescription
OEM PartsInitial parts made by the producer, guaranteeing quality and compatibility.
Aftermarket PartsThird-party parts that may boost efficiency but differ in quality.
Efficiency PartsUpgraded parts created to improve speed, power, and handling.
DevicesProducts that boost the truck's usability or aesthetic appeal, such as bed liners, tonneau covers, and flooring mats.
Maintenance PartsNecessary products for regular maintenance, such as oil filters, brake pads, and trigger plugs.

Frequently Asked Questions About Dodge Ram Parts Dealers

1. How do I understand if a part is suitable with my Dodge Ram?

Consult your owner's handbook or speak directly with a well-informed dealership. They can assist in ensuring that the part works with your specific design and year.

2. Are aftermarket parts good quality?

Aftermarket parts can differ widely in quality. It's vital to buy from trusted sources and check reviews. Some aftermarket parts are created to exceed OEM specifications.

3. Can I return parts if they do not fit?

Many dealerships have return policies; nevertheless, this can vary extensively. Constantly examine the return policy before making a purchase.

4. What is the difference between OEM and aftermarket parts?

OEM parts are made by the manufacturer and are generally thought about more reliable.  Dodge Ram Aftermarket Parts USA  are made by third-party business and can differ in quality, rate, and efficiency.

5. How frequently should I replace upkeep parts?

It depends upon the kind of part and usage. For instance, oil filters are often altered with every oil modification (typically every 5,000-7,500 miles), while brake pads may need changing every 30,000 to 70,000 miles.
